-California Roots: Born in a Garage 🏠🛠️

Ponder this: In 1966, two visionaries—Paul Van Doren and Serge Delia—opened a small shoe factory in Anaheim, California. Their mission? To craft durable, affordable shoes for everyday people. Enter the #Authentic (originally called Style 36), which quickly became a hit among surfers and skaters because of its grippy sole and rugged design. 🏄‍♂️🛹 Fun fact? Back then, customers could pick colors on-site—it was like IKEA meets sneakers! 🎨➡️👟


-Skate Culture Revolution: From Ramps to Runways 🚀

Fast forward to the ’70s and ’80s when skateboarding exploded into pop culture. Tony Hawk, Rodney Mullen, and other legends laced up their Vans for legendary tricks. Why Vans? Because the vulcanized rubber soles offered unmatched board feel and control. Plus, they were cheap enough that even broke teens could afford them. 💸 But here’s where it gets wild—Vans didn’t just stay at the ramps; they strutted onto runways too. By the 2000s, celebs from Avril Lavigne to Justin Bieber rocked checkerboard patterns, turning Vans into a fashion statement as much as a skate staple. ✨➡️👗
